6 Yoga Therapy in Cancer Care Ideally Includes: –Deepening spiritual connection (Anandamaya) –Having a purpose in life –Embracing social support –Taking control over one’s health (Vignamaya) –Following one’s intuition –Releasing suppressed emotions (Manomaya) –Increase positive emotions –Using herbs and supplements (Pranamaya & Annamaya) –Radically changing the diet – 7 Beyond Cancer: Creating Spaces for Focused Inquiry • My experience with Retreats – 21 days, group – max 8; 6hrs yoga therapy/day; (, , , yoga Nidra, , chanting, education) – Profound healing on all levels –Published research • www.yogaforhealth.institute • “Healing Through Yoga Therapy: A Whole-Person Approach To Health” SYTAR 2020 – 8 Harry When we reviewed together improved test results at the end of retreat Harry said: “Yes – that’s about how I feel, at peace with myself and the world. And one more thing… when I came to the program I was afraid of death; now I am not. I will live as long as I can and spend as much time with my sons as possible”. Four weeks later we learned that Harry passed away peacefully, surrounded by his family and friends. The referring medical doctor commented “This Beyond Cancer retreat was the best present we could give him before passing on”. 9 Spirituality, Yoga & Healing • Yoga interventions in cancer patients reported improvements in measures of spirituality relative to control group –conscious interaction, compassion, lightheartedness and mindfulness • Spiritual transformation is achieved in prisons: –Intensive practices and group setting –Personality changes, connection to Self or HP – 2 10 In a word 1
